PrimeVue (v4, v3) support for the FormKit validation Framwork
FormKit is a library that provides PrimeVue based FormKit Inputs for using FormKit with the PrimeVue UI Framework. The main focus of this project is to offer configuration-based forms with validation, with the ability to use the same pattern for data output from schema using PrimeOutputs.
useFormKitSchema and useInputEditorSchema simplify usage of elements and component schema generation.FormKit is a powerful tool that leverages PrimeVue components to streamline the creation of configuration-based forms with validation. By offering a range of styling options, schema helper functions, and demo applications, FormKit simplifies the process of building dynamic forms within the PrimeVue UI Framework.
Vite is a build tool that aims to provide a faster and leaner development experience for modern web projects
VitePress is a static site generator designed for creating documentation websites. It offers a lightweight and fast development experience using Vue.js and Markdown, with features such as live-reload, theming, and customizable layout components.
Vue.js is a lightweight and flexible JavaScript framework that allows developers to easily build dynamic and reactive user interfaces. Its intuitive syntax, modular architecture, and focus on performance make it a popular choice for modern web development.
SCSS is a preprocessor scripting language that extends the capabilities of CSS by adding features such as variables, nesting, and mixins. It allows developers to write more efficient and maintainable CSS code, and helps to streamline the development process by reducing repetition and increasing reusability.
UnoCSS is an instant, on-demand atomic CSS engine that generates utility classes at build time. It's highly customizable, extremely fast, and compatible with Tailwind CSS utilities while offering additional features like attributify mode and pure CSS icons.
ESLint is a linter for JavaScript that analyzes code to detect and report on potential problems and errors, as well as enforce consistent code style and best practices, helping developers to write cleaner, more maintainable code.
TypeScript is a superset of JavaScript, providing optional static typing, classes, interfaces, and other features that help developers write more maintainable and scalable code. TypeScript's static typing system can catch errors at compile-time, making it easier to build and maintain large applications.
